Terminology

Decompensation in MH doesn’t mean permanent illness, and positive changes and interventions can support recovery. Early identification of and response to distress can make a big difference.

Interventions That Support Mental Health

Psychotherapy: Talk therapy to process emotions, build coping skills, and enhance MH functioning.

Emotional Support Animal:
Companion animals providing comfort, reducing stress, and supporting emotional wellbeing.

Caregiving: Ongoing daily support with ADLs/IADLs, ensuring safety, stability, and continuity of care.

Care Team Coordination: Collaborative care planning through provider communication and case conferencing.

Medical Care & Prescriptions:
Psychiatric evaluation, medication, and guidance to reduce symptoms and support stability.

Peer Support: Guidance and encouragement from individuals with lived mental health experiences.

Inpatient MH Care: Structured, short-term hospital stay for safe stabilization and intensive treatment.

MH Care Navigation: Assistance with appointments, medication adherence, and advocacy to support engagement.

Use DMH Referrals to Connect ICMS Participants to LA County’s Behavioral Health Care Continuum

Housing Supportive Services Program (HSSP): Site-based MH services in PSH buildings
Universal Entry Referral: Unified entry point and triage for all MH service levels

Confirm universal sharing consent status before submitting MH care referrals.

Responding to a Mental Health Crisis

Urgent Scenario:

  • First, check for on-site MH support.
  • Offer Psychiatric Urgent Care.
  • Dial 988 for Suicide & Crisis Lifeline.
  • 24/7 Help Line is always available: (1-800-854-7771)
  • Notify supervisor and relevant staff.

Emergency

  • Take action to address immediate safety risk(s).
  • Dial 911, provide callback # and location, and describe situation and any person(s) involved.
  • Notify supervisor and relevant staff.

The multilingual 24/7 Help Line (1-800-854-7771) is a unified entry point for mental health and substance use care in LA County.

PH² is an advanced outreach option for participants at risk of eviction who aren’t engaged in MH services and who reside in buildings without onsite HSSP. If your PSH building has HSSP onsite, contact HSSP instead.
